Mice Model Market竞争格局

The market is moderately consolidated, with a few global suppliers controlling a significant share through breeding scale, strain catalogs, and global logistics. Competitive advantage depends on genetic quality, pathogen control, custom model capability, and reliable delivery timelines.

价格分析

Average pricing has remained firm because specialized models require controlled breeding, pathogen-free housing, and quality validation. Standard strains are more price competitive, while custom engineered and PDX models command premium pricing.

成本构成 占比(%)
Breeding colonies and animal husbandry 34%
Laboratory staff and animal care labor 22%
Genotyping, validation, and quality testing 16%
Facility overhead and biosecurity compliance 18%
Packaging, logistics, and distribution 10%

Typical gross margins range from 18% to 28%, with higher margins in custom and disease-specific models and lower margins in commoditized standard strains.

制造与生产分析

Setting up a mice model breeding and supply operation requires investment in barrier facilities, HVAC, cage-wash systems, genotyping labs, and animal health monitoring. Capital requirements are high for clean rooms, colony expansion, and biosecurity controls.

Key Machinery & Equipment
  • Barrier housing systems
  • Ventilated cage racks
  • Autoclaves and cage washers
  • PCR and genotyping equipment
  • 环境监测系统
Manufacturing Process Flow
  • Foundation breeding and colony stabilization
  • Genetic validation and health screening
  • Barrier housing and biosecurity monitoring
  • Breeding, weaning, and inventory management
  • Packaging, shipment, and cold-chain or live-animal logistics

市场动态

Drivers
  • Rising use of mice models in oncology and immunology research
  • Expanding drug discovery and preclinical testing pipelines
  • Growth in genetically engineered models for target validation
  • Increasing outsourcing of animal studies to specialized research providers
Restraints
  • High breeding and facility operating costs
  • Ethical scrutiny and pressure to reduce animal use
  • Regulatory complexity across regions
  • Substitution pressure from organoids, cell models, and computational tools
Opportunities
  • Expansion of personalized medicine studies using PDX mice
  • Higher adoption of transgenic and humanized models
  • Growth of contract research and breeding services in Asia Pacific
  • Demand for immuno-oncology and rare disease research models
Challenges
  • Maintaining genetic consistency and pathogen-free status
  • Capacity constraints for specialized strains
  • Long breeding cycles for complex models
  • Managing compliance with animal welfare and biosafety standards
